Garrett Haake Biography and Wiki
Garrett Haake is an American journalist serving as the Washington Correspondent for MSNBC. He is known for covering everything from Congress and the White House to battles and typhoons as a system journalist from Washington.
He is also known for his NBC Nightly News job with Lester Holt(1970), NBC News Special: Ted Kennedy’s Funeral(2009), and The Ben Shapiro Show(2015).

Garrett Haake Education
Garrett enrolled and later graduated from Klein High School in the class of 2003. He later joined Southern Methodist University, where he graduated with a Bachelor’s degree in Journalism. While in college, he was a President’s Scholar and engaged with extra-curricular exercises. He was also an individual from the Lambda Chi Alpha club.

Garrett Haake Wife and Married
Garrett is married to Sara Murray CNN journalist Sara Murray. The pair met in 2011 on then-presidential candidate Mitt Romney’s tour bus. They began dating shortly after becoming acquainted with each other. In 2015, November 28, Garett proposed to Sara to be his life partner. The ceremony was attended by close friends and family members.
The pair later exchanged the vows on April 24, 2017, after two years near Austin, Texas. The pair along with their child resides in Washington DC and sharing the happily married life as from 2017 with no such conflict.

Garrett Haake Career and NBC
Garrett began his career at NBC Nightly News in New York. He later turned into a partner maker at NBC Nightly News in New York from 2009 to 2011. He was then chosen as one of the eight installed correspondents of NBC News covering the 2012 Presidential decisions. He later secured Mitt Romney’s Presidential campaign. He later joined the KSHB-TV as a general task journalist where he secured everything from legislative issues and outrage to wrongdoing and climate.
Garrett Haake 60 Minutes
Garrett relocated to Kandahar in 2014, where he detailed and shot 60 minutes in length narrative about the finish of the United States’ contribution in the war of Afghanistan.
Garrett Haake WUSA-TV
Garrett started working at WUSA-TV. After two years, he later filtered to MSNBC as a reporter and began announcing from Capitol Hill. To add to this, Haake won two Emmy Awards for his natural and narrative revealing.

Garrett Haake Nominations and Awards
- Two Emmy Awards for his environmental and documentary reporting. Furthermore, he has been nominated for the Emmys for five times. His nominations came in 2010, 2011 and 2012.
- In 2010, his work in NBC News Special: The Funeral Of Ted Kennedy earned him a nomination. Also, that same year, his work on Perfect Storm: Climate Change and Conflict also earned him a nomination of Best Story in a Regularly Scheduled Newcast.
- Similarly, in 2011, his work for Earthquake in Haiti earned him a nomination for the Emmys of Outstanding Coverage of a Breaking News Story in a Regularly Scheduled Newscast.
- In 2012, he earned two Emmys in 2012 for “Blown Away: Southern Tornadoes”. This was for Best Story in a Regularly Scheduled Newscast and also, for the Outstanding Coverage of a Breaking News Story in a Regularly Scheduled Newscast.s.
